Key Responsibilities

Health & Safety

  • Develop and review risk assessments annually
  • Conduct COSHH assessments and maintain Safety Data Sheets
  • Carry out monthly safety tours and workplace inspections
  • Oversee emergency lighting checks, fire alarm testing (weekly), and fire drills (6-monthly)
  • Manage manual handling assessments, racking inspections, and LOLER certifications
  • Ensure compliance with LEV testing, asbestos checks, and Peninsula Health & Safety (Business Safe) regulations
  • Maintain safety and maintenance documentation and training records

Quality Management

  • Conduct and support ISO 9001 audits and maintain documentation
  • Assist with ISO 14001 compliance and prepare for ISO 45001 certification
  • Manage and update quality policy documents and quality control checks
  • Oversee FSC compliance, carbon & QDT pellet sample testing, and spreadsheet management
  • Handle quality rejects and resolve any product quality concerns

HR Support

  • Provide HR administrative support, including note-taking during meetings if required
